WARNING: If the IGC must be replaced, be sure to ground yourself to dissipate any electrical charge that may be present before handling new control board. The IGC is sensitive to static electricity and may be damaged if the necessary precautions are not taken.

Table 19 Ð Heating Service Analysis
PROBLEM | CAUSE | REMEDY |
Burners will not | Misaligned spark electrodes. | Check ¯ame ignition and sensor electrode positioning. Adjust as needed. |
ignite. | No gas at main burners. | Check gas line for air, purge as necessary. After purging gas line of air, allow gas |
|
| to dissipate for at least 5 minutes before attempting to relight unit. |
|
| Check gas valve. |
| Water in gas line. | Drain water and install drip leg to trap water. |
| No power to furnace. | Check power supply, fuses, wiring, and circuit breaker. |
| No 24 v power supply to | Check transformer. Transformers with internal overcurrent protection require a cool |
| control circuit. | down period before resetting. Check |
| Miswired or loose connections. | Check all wiring and wirenut connections. |

| Broken thermostat wires. | Run continuity check. Replace wires, if necessary. |
Inadequate heating. | Dirty air ®lter. | Clean or replace ®lter as necessary. |
| Gas input to unit too low. | Check gas pressure at manifold. Clock gas meter for input. If too low, increase |
|
| manifold pressure, or replace with correct ori®ces. |
| Unit undersized for application. | Replace with proper unit or add additional unit. |
| Restricted air¯ow. | Clean ®lter, replace ®lter, or remove any restrictions. |
